Popular Free Radio Apps
Several free radio apps offer users unique features and experiences, enhancing music, news, and entertainment enjoyment. Below are details on some top apps in this space.
Features of Top Apps
- TuneIn Radio: TuneIn Radio provides access to over 100,000 live radio stations globally, alongside a vast library of podcasts. Users can create personalized playlists and explore curated content based on interests.
- iHeartRadio: iHeartRadio offers live radio streaming from thousands of stations, customizable playlists, and artist radio features. The app also includes exclusive shows and events for users seeking unique experiences.
- Radio Garden: Radio Garden introduces a visual interactive map, allowing users to explore live radio stations worldwide by rotating a globe. It enables easy discovery of diverse local radio stations and music styles.
- Simple Radio: Simple Radio focuses on user convenience, offering a minimalist interface to access favorite stations quickly. It supports background listening and includes a sleep timer for added utility.
- Pandora: While primarily a music streaming service, Pandora allows users to listen to personalized radio stations based on music preferences. The app adapts selections using user feedback to improve personalization.

Limitations of Free Radio Apps
Free radio apps offer numerous benefits, yet they come with notable limitations that users should consider.
- Advertisement Interruptions: Users experience frequent advertisements in free versions, which disrupts the seamless listening experience. These interruptions can lead to frustration.
- Limited Features: Many free radio apps restrict advanced features. Premium content, offline listening capabilities, and exclusive shows often require subscriptions, hindering full access to all potential offerings.
- Sound Quality Variations: Streaming quality may fluctuate due to varying internet connections. Users in areas with weak signals or limited bandwidth might encounter buffering or lower audio quality.
- Inconsistent Availability: Not all regional stations are available through free apps. Users may find specific local channels missing, which limits access to desired content.
- Privacy Concerns: Free radio apps may collect user data for advertising purposes. Users often face risks related to privacy as their listening habits might be tracked without explicit consent.
- Device Compatibility: Some apps might not function on older devices or operating systems. Compatibility issues can restrict users from enjoying radio content on their preferred platforms.
